QT - Qt vs. Visual Studio

 
Vista:

Qt vs. Visual Studio

Publicado por Santiago (1 intervención) el 24/02/2021 09:36:28
-Hola, explico mi situación con todo detalle... Hace poco me descargue Qt, al principio todo bien, perfecto, ayer me descargue Visual Studio 2019 y ahora, apenas al iniciar Qt en la pestaña de 'issues' me aparece lo siguiente...



:-1: error: Failed to retrieve MSVC Environment from "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at x86":
The command "C:\WINDOWS\system32\cmd.exe:C:\MinGW\bin" could not be started.


:-1: error: Failed to retrieve MSVC Environment from "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at x86":
The command "C:\WINDOWS\system32\cmd.exe:C:\MinGW\bin" could not be started.

:-1: error: Failed to retrieve MSVC Environment from "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at amd64_x86":
The command "C:\WINDOWS\system32\cmd.exe:C:\MinGW\bin" could not be started.

:-1: error: Failed to retrieve MSVC Environment from "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at amd64_x86":
The command "C:\WINDOWS\system32\cmd.exe:C:\MinGW\bin" could not be started.


:-1: error: Failed to retrieve MSVC Environment from "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at amd64":
The command "C:\WINDOWS\system32\cmd.exe:C:\MinGW\bin" could not be started.


:-1: error: Failed to retrieve MSVC Environment from "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at amd64":
The command "C:\WINDOWS\system32\cmd.exe:C:\MinGW\bin" could not be started.

:-1: error: Failed to retrieve MSVC Environment from "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at x86_amd64":
The command "C:\WINDOWS\system32\cmd.exe:C:\MinGW\bin" could not be started.

:-1: error: Failed to retrieve MSVC Environment from "C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Auxiliary\Build\vcvarsall.bat x86_amd64":
The command "C:\WINDOWS\system32\cmd.exe:C:\MinGW\bin" could not be started.


- Alguien sabrá algo?
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
sin imagen de perfil

Qt vs. Visual Studio

Publicado por Rolando José (9 intervenciones) el 27/03/2025 03:36:19
Algunas versiones de Qt Creator, Visual Studio o incluso Windows pueden ser incompatibles o requerir configuraciones específicas.

lo mejor es trabajar con software OpenSource, tanto el IDE como las librerias, un ide que este hecho en QT o un GUI mas compatible con las versiones de Windows, es posible que se necesite el compilador que usaron para hacer las librerias de QT, o compilarlas con MSVC compatible, lo mejor es no centrarte en usar un IDE tan especifico y buscar un IDE mas compatible como I.DLE. o usar Tkinter el GUI mas compatible para python.

La mitad del problema basicamente es que QT6 no tiene codigo fuente publico, como lo tiene python
la otra mitad del problema es Visual Studio tampoco es Opensource, por lo que no hay a ciencia cierta como resolver el problema.

Lo que puedes hacer es no usar QT sino un GUI de Codigo abierto como Tkinter, y un IDE e codigo abierto, ojala con compatibilidad probada con el GUI elegido, lo cual puede ser Spyder o IDLE que tiene compatibilidad comprobada con QT y Tkinter.

lo otro seria probar cosas como instalar Visual Studio que incluya el componente "Desarrollo para escritorio con C++".

Si resulves el problema nos gustaria que compartas como lo solucionaste.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ar